After dropping the buzzing visual for the hit song “Poles Inna Whip” last November, emerging Maryland artist Zayzayy returns — with a promising 2021 in store — starting with the release of the new video to the new single “G Shock.”

The Justin Jacobs-directed video for the song, which also prepares fans for the forthcoming album Start of Forever as the lead single, sees the thriving rapper pull a large home invasion that results in a high-speed chase with an unknown ending. Lyrically, Zayzayy is starving for blue hunnits and delivers a couple of money-hungry verses by any means necessary like the first verse, he raps: “Mask down, searching for a lick till the sun up/Mask down, gotta move these pounds until I come up/I was 15, robbin the runners.”

One of the most popular watches in today’s fashion, G-Shock is a resistant military and tactical watches with outstanding water-resistant features. A brand that Zayzayy has been a fan of since childhood and the inspiration behind his new single, “I made the songs thinking about ways to come up,” Zayzayy said in the press release. “Growing up g shock was the watches everyone wanted and I remember days I could afford it. So we took risks to get it. G-Shock symbolizes me one a better life. Me wanting the best things in life.”

“G Shock” is the new release and apart of a new direction for the rising artist. It’s his first release under the new label All Season Records, which is in conjunction with the popular Create Music Group. The release of the video follows Zayzayy’s 2020 album release Beyond The Naked Eye. Now, he is setting up the drop of his next album — coming sometime-2021 — that fans can find daily updates on his Instagram.

Hip Hop beef may be back, but the antics are on another level. Rick Ross didn’t take Drake’s recent dis track Push-Ups lightly. Rozay immediately took to the studio to comeback at the ‘white boy’ with a dis of his own entitled Champagne Moments. The MMG CEO explains that he is on a different level of gangster and the Instagram antics can’t get him out of a luxurious seat in his private hanger. While exposing fandom audio, switchable accusations, and fake body parts, Rozay says this beef has to end face to face. Let us know your thoughts on the official video below. In the bustling streets of Southeast, Washington DC, rapper Kazon’s latest offering, “My Brother,” emerges as a symphony of redemption and advocacy, resonating with audiences far and wide.

Kazon’s path to musical stardom has been fraught with obstacles, from brushes with the law to a brush with death that left him scarred but unbroken. Through it all, he credits his resilience to the belief that every setback is an opportunity for growth.

With “My Brother,” Kazon takes on the role of a lyrical mentor, offering guidance and solace to Black youth grappling with violence and systemic oppression. Through heartfelt verses and melodic refrains, he shares his own journey of redemption, using his past mistakes as a catalyst for change.

At its core, “My Brother” is a call to action—a plea for unity, love, and advocacy within the Black community. Kazon’s harmonious tale serves as a reminder that through solidarity and advocacy, we can effect real change and pave the way for a brighter future.
